Travel Mammography Technologist
Location
Richmond, Virginia
Schedule / Job Type
Contract | Travel | Days | Monday–Friday, 7:30 AM – 4:00 PM; occasional Saturday half-days every 3–4 months | 13-Week Assignment
Key Responsibilities
- Independently perform screening and diagnostic mammography examinations
- Operate Hologic mammography equipment, including contrast enhanced mammography (CEM)
- Utilize documentation systems for image capture, registration, and high-risk breast program tracking
- Deliver high-quality patient care within a breast diagnostic center setting
- Collaborate effectively as part of a multidisciplinary imaging team
Required Qualifications
- ARRT certification in Mammography
- Current Basic Cardiac Life Support (BCLS) certification
- Minimum 2 years of mammography experience
- Ability to work independently performing both screening and diagnostic exams
- Strong patient care and teamwork skills
Preferred Experience / Skills
- Experience with Hologic mammography equipment, including contrast enhanced mammography (CEM)
- Familiarity with mammography-specific documentation and image management systems
- Experience in a breast diagnostic or high-risk breast program environment
